| 1:08.6 | And Riley Fessler, how are you, Riley? Pretty good. Why don't you kick us off Riley? So the White House has |
| 1:16.3 | made it clear that the United States will not be involved in any |
| 1:19.5 | retaliatory strikes by Israel against Iran. Following an attack Iran launched over 300 |
| 1:25.0 | drones and missiles at Israel in response to an Israeli strike on its consulate |
| 1:29.4 | in Syria earlier this month. The majority of the projectiles were intercepted by Israeli, U.S. and |
| 1:35.4 | Allied defenses, and President Joe Biden has advised the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u |
| 1:40.7 | to deliberate carefully on how to respond to Iran's unprecedented direct attack. |
| 1:45.8 | The advice was given amidst discussions on how to de-escalate the situation despite some U.S. |
| 1:50.9 | lawmakers and officials urging for a more robust response. |
| 1:55.0 | So I think this is clearly an attempt to kind of de-escalate the situation and avoid a wider regional conflict. |
